Ripple destroys 15 million RLUSD tokens, raising its market value to US$2.42 billion.
Ripple confirmed on the Ethereum blockchain on Thursday that it completed the destruction of 15 million Ripple USD (RLUSD) tokens. It is estimated that the value of the destroyed tokens is approximately US$15 million, and the funds have been transferred from the RLUSD treasury to an empty address in Ethereum.
Recently, RLUSD casting and destruction activities have intensified
Chain data shows that major casting and redemption transactions involving RLUSD have occurred frequently in the past week. On September 8, the market observed that 10 million RLUSDs were destroyed, and approximately 14.39 million RLUSDs were cast shortly thereafter. The day before, September 7, 18 million RLUSD were cast on Ethereum. In addition, 20 million RLUSDs were cast on September 4, compared with 16 million the previous day.
The issuance and destruction of RLUSD reflect institutional needs. When customers redeem positions, the corresponding tokens will be destroyed. Such activity is routine in asset-backed stablecoins and usually does not indicate a negative view of the market on the product.
The market value of RLUSD is growing rapidly
Despite destruction activities, the circulating supply of RLUSD in the stablecoin market remains strong. CoinGecko data shows that as of September 10, the market value of RLUSD was approximately US$2.42 billion. In contrast, its market value on August 18 was only about US$1.76 billion, a significant increase.
If this expansion trend continues, RLUSD is expected to soon surpass other major stablecoins such as PayPal USD (PYUSD) in terms of total market capitalisation.
Ripple's strategic expansion and institutional collaboration
RLUSD has attracted much attention due to its growing institutional use cases. In August, Ripple partnered with Clearpool and Cicada Partners to support the development of an institutional credit fund based on XRP Ledger. The initiative aims to expand the integration and application of RLUSD in the digital asset market.
As a U.S.-based fintech company, Ripple operates the U.S. dollar-pegged stablecoin RLUSD and issues the asset on multiple blockchains to serve the digital finance, payments and lending needs of institutions. The company is committed to positioning RLUSD not only as a payment infrastructure, but also in the areas of tokenization, lending and collateral management in the institutional market.
RLUSD minting and destruction activities reflect real institutional demand: tokens are issued and redeemed based on customer demand, and destroyed tokens represent redemption behavior rather than market bearish signals.
Noun explanation: Clearpool and Cicada Partners, institutional finance projects focusing on blockchain-based credit and lending solutions, are working together with Ripple to promote the integration of RLUSD into the digital asset market.
